Why do I receive an error when running command "startworker" for the MATLAB Parallel Server?

조회 수: 3 (최근 30일)
I've installed MATLAB R2020b on a head node and multiple worker nodes. All run RHEL 7.8. I've confirmed that the MATLAB and parallel server licenses are correct and have no licensing errors. I've successfully started MJS service on the head and worker nodes and verified with "nodestatus" command. I successfully started a MJS job manager on the head node named "myMJS". When I start a worker via the command:
./startworker -jobmanagerhost <HEADNODE> -jobmanager <myMJS> -remotehost <WORKERNODE>
I get an error stating:
The mjs service on the host <WORKERNODE>
returned the following error:
Problem starting the MATLAB worker.
=============================================================
matlabExecutable must be of the form '<release string>=<path to executable>;<release string>=<path to executable>;'. Actual string:
Note, there is no "actual string" given in the error message as if no command is being passed.
What am I doing wrong or could troubleshoot the issue further?
